Text

(a)(1) When it is discovered by an employee, employer, or a state retirement system that an employee became erroneously enrolled in a state retirement system on or after January 1, 1979, the employee may elect to remain a member of the retirement system of record or may become a member of the eligible retirement system.
(2)Subsections (b)-
(d)of this section shall apply if the member chooses to become a member of the eligible retirement system.
(b)The retirement system of record shall refund to the employer all contributions, both employee and employer, that were made in behalf of the employee in question.
